2021 High-cost Counties/Metropolitan Statistical Areas (MSA) 2020 CONFORMING & HIGH BALANCE LOAN LIMITS BY COUNTY FOR FREDDIE & FANNIE (AS OF 1/01/2020) The Federal Housing Finance Agency’s (FHFA) announcement to increase the 2020 conforming loan limits for mortgages acquired by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ac to $510,400 on one-unit properties and a cap of $765,600 in high-cost areas. CalHFA allows: • Customary lender origination fees not to exceed the greater of 3% of the loan amount or $3,000 • Other customary third-party fees such as the credit report fee, appraisal fee, insurance fee or similar settlement or financing cost.
